The Essential Guide to Choosing Your First Camera

Starting photography is exciting! Picking the right camera makes a big difference. This guide helps you find the perfect tool for your new hobby.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op, watch for these important parts. They control how well your camera works.

Sensor Size Matters

The sensor is like the camera’s eye. Bigger sensors capture more light. This means clearer pictures, especially when it is dark. Look for APS-C sensors as a great starting point. They offer good quality without being too big or expensive.

Megapixels: How Much Detail?

Megapixels tell you how many tiny dots make up your image. For beginners, 18 to 24 megapixels is plenty. You can print big pictures without losing sharpness.

Shooting Speed (Frames Per Second – FPS)

FPS shows how many pictures the camera takes in one second. If you want to photograph fast action, like sports or pets, a higher FPS (like 5 or more) helps you catch the perfect moment.

Video Capabilities

Do you want to shoot videos too? Check if the camera shoots in 1080p (Full HD) or 4K. 4K is sharper but needs more storage space.

Important Materials and Build Quality

The body of the camera needs to feel good in your hands. It needs to last, too.

  • Body Material: Most entry-level cameras use strong plastic shells. This keeps them light. Higher-end cameras use magnesium alloy, which is tougher but heavier.
  • Lens Mount: Make sure the lens mount (where the lens connects) is sturdy. You will likely change lenses later.
  • Screen Type: A good screen helps you see your shot. Touchscreens are very helpful for quick adjustments. Tilting or fully articulating screens let you shoot from low or high angles easily.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

The camera body is only half the story. The lens affects quality a lot.

Lens Quality is Key

A cheap kit lens comes with the camera, and it is okay to start. However, better lenses create sharper, clearer photos with better colors. Always remember: a good lens on a basic camera often beats a bad lens on an expensive camera.

Image Stabilization

Image stabilization helps prevent blurry photos when you hold the camera still. Some cameras have it built-in (In-Body Image Stabilization or IBIS). Others have it built into the lens. Both methods help beginners get steady shots.

Autofocus System

A fast and accurate autofocus system is crucial. It quickly locks onto your subject. Look for cameras with many autofocus points across the screen. Slow autofocus reduces your ability to capture sharp images quickly.

User Experience and Use Cases

How the camera feels and what you plan to shoot guides your final decision.

Ergonomics (How it Feels)

You must feel comfortable holding the camera for long periods. If the camera is too small or too big for your hands, you will not enjoy using it. Try holding different models in a store if you can.

Portability

Are you hiking or traveling often? Smaller mirrorless cameras are lighter than traditional DSLRs. Weight matters when you carry gear all day.

Use Cases: What Will You Shoot?

  • Portraits/Street Photography: Smaller mirrorless cameras are discreet and excellent for these styles.
  • Sports/Wildlife: You need faster shooting speeds and longer lenses, often found in slightly larger DSLR or advanced mirrorless bodies.
  • Vlogging/Video: Look for a camera with a flip-out screen and a good microphone jack.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) for Camera Starters

Q: Should I buy a DSLR or a Mirrorless camera?

A: Mirrorless cameras are newer, lighter, and often have better video features. DSLRs are usually a bit cheaper for the same performance level right now. Both take great photos.

Q: Is a camera with a touchscreen better?

A: Yes, touchscreens make setting focus points or changing settings much faster and easier for beginners.

Q: Do I need 4K video?

A: Not really when starting out. Good 1080p video quality is usually enough for social media and sharing with friends.

Q: What is a “Kit Lens”?

A: The kit lens is the basic lens that often comes bundled with the camera body. It is versatile but usually not the sharpest option.

Q: How much storage do I need for photos?

A: Start with an SD card that holds at least 64GB. Faster cards (look for U3 speed ratings) help the camera save pictures quickly.

Q: Does the brand name matter a lot for a first camera?

A: Brand matters less at the entry level. Canon, Nikon, Sony, and Fujifilm all make excellent beginner cameras. Focus on features and feel.

Q: Can I use my old camera lenses?

A: Sometimes, but you might need an adapter. It is usually easiest to buy new lenses designed for your specific camera system.

Q: What is the benefit of manual mode?

A: Manual mode gives you total control over aperture, shutter speed, and ISO. Learning this improves your pictures greatly over time.

Q: How important is the battery life?

A: Very important! Mirrorless cameras often use more power than DSLRs. Check online reviews to see how many shots you get per charge.

Q: When should I upgrade my lens?

A: Upgrade when you notice the kit lens limits what you want to shoot—for example, if you need better low-light performance or want blurry backgrounds for portraits.
